Peaks Mt. Garfield, NH
Trails
Trails: Gale River Road, Garfield Trail, Garfield Ridge Trail

Date of Hike: Sunday, December 23, 2012
Parking/Access Road Notes
Parking/Access Road Notes: Plenty of parking outside the gate. 
Surface Conditions
Surface Conditions: Snow - Packed Powder/Loose Granular, Snow - Trace/Minimal Depth 
Recommended Equipment
Recommended Equipment: Snowshoes, Light Traction 
Water Crossing Notes
Water Crossing Notes: We took the two BW to avoid both brook crossings. 
Trail Maintenance Notes
Trail Maintenance Notes: I remember one huge duck under that we took a couple of branches off but otherwise the trail is in great shape.

Comments: There was a couple of inches of very fluffy snow over ice on the road walk. Traction may be helpful there. We put on snowshoes soon after the reroute and above the brook crossings. There were four ahead of us who had broken trail. May have been as much as 6 inches of new snow up high. Several feet of snow in the woods made for a very wintery scene.The trek down was absolutely fantastic. Thanks to Ali, Sarah and Hannah.
